As a Maine homebuyer, you have access to valuable state-specific programs that a local lender will be well-versed in. The MaineHousing First Home Loan Program is a prime example. It offers competitive, fixed-rate mortgages with down payment and closing cost assistance to eligible buyers. A lender familiar with this program can quickly tell you if you qualify and seamlessly guide you through the application, potentially making homeownership in West Kennebunk more affordable than you thought.
Your actionable plan should look like this: First, get pre-approved by at least two or three different types of lenders—perhaps a local credit union, a community bank, and a reputable mortgage broker. This allows you to compare not just interest rates, but also fees, responsiveness, and the clarity of their communication. When you speak with them, ask pointed questions: "How familiar are you with recent sales in West Kennebunk?" or "Can you walk me through the MaineHousing options?" Their answers will reveal their local savvy.
